Shopify FedEx Carrier-Calculated Rates Broken? Fix the 'Unexpected Problem' Error
Imagine this: Your Shopify store is humming along, customers are happy, and your shipping rates are displaying perfectly at checkout. Then, an email from Shopify lands in your inbox – a routine request to reconnect your carrier account for an update. You click, follow the steps, and expect business as usual. But instead, your entire shipping rate system grinds to a halt, leaving customers staring at an empty shipping options page.
This frustrating scenario recently plagued numerous Shopify store owners, both in the EU and the US, particularly those relying on the native FedEx integration for carrier-calculated rates. What started as a simple reconnect request quickly escalated into a persistent 'unexpected problem' error, disrupting crucial checkout functionality.
The Dreaded 'Unexpected Problem' Error: A Deep Dive
The core of the issue, as highlighted by users like marcheinteretgeneral and simbp in the Shopify Community forums, manifests during the final stage of FedEx's security verification. After being redirected from Shopify to FedEx to complete the reconnection process, all initial steps appear to validate correctly. However, at the crucial final confirmation, users are met with a generic and unhelpful message:
"The system has experienced an unexpected problem. Please try again later."
This error prevents the connection from completing, effectively breaking the display of real-time FedEx shipping rates at checkout. What makes this particularly vexing is that other FedEx functionalities, such as generating shipping labels via FedEx Ship Manager, often continue to work without a hitch. This clearly indicates that the problem isn't a simple credentials mismatch but something more complex within the Shopify-FedEx integration.
Why is This Happening? Unpacking the Root Cause
Based on the collective experience of affected merchants and the nature of the error, the problem strongly points towards an OAuth / API handshake issue on Shopify's side, rather than a misconfiguration on the merchant's or FedEx's end. Here's why:
- Not a Credentials Issue: Many users confirmed their FedEx accounts were active, and even generating new Production Meters via the FedEx Developer Portal and enabling the Rate API module on FedEx's side didn't resolve the issue.
- Specific Failure Point: The error consistently appears during the final security verification step, suggesting a failure in how Shopify and FedEx's systems authenticate and establish the API connection for rate calculation.
- Backend Reset as a Fix: Some reports from EU stores hinted that a manual backend reset of the carrier integration by Shopify support was the only effective solution, further supporting the theory of an underlying platform-level glitch.
Troubleshooting Steps That Didn't Work (and What They Tell Us)
Merchants diligently attempted various troubleshooting steps, which, while unsuccessful, helped narrow down the problem's scope:
- Removing and Reconnecting: Completely deleting the FedEx account from Shopify and attempting a fresh connection.
- Browser-Related Fixes: Clearing browser cache and cookies, or trying to reconnect in incognito/private mode.
- FedEx Account Verification: Generating new Production Meters, confirming meter activity, and ensuring the Rate API module was enabled by FedEx support.
- Shopify Settings Checks: Re-checking Web Services and negotiated rates settings, and re-saving shipping zones prior to reconnecting.
The fact that none of these standard fixes worked underscores that the issue lies deeper than typical user-side errors or basic account misconfigurations. It's a testament to the complexity of integrating external APIs, especially when mandatory updates are pushed.
Navigating the Solution: What to Do When Your Rates Break
If you find yourself in this predicament, here's a strategic approach:
1. Document Everything & Contact Shopify Support Immediately
This is your first and most crucial step. Provide Shopify Support with detailed information:
- The exact error message and where it appears.
- Screenshots of the process, including the error.
- A list of all troubleshooting steps you've already attempted.
- Confirmation from FedEx support that your account and API access are active.
- Mention that other merchants are experiencing similar issues, particularly after a reconnect request, and that it appears to be an OAuth/API handshake problem. Request an escalation for a backend reset of the carrier integration.
2. Consider Temporary Shipping Workarounds
While Shopify investigates, you can't leave your customers without shipping options. Consider these temporary solutions:
- Flat Rate Shipping: Implement temporary flat rates for different zones or order values.
- Price-Based or Weight-Based Rates: Set up basic rates based on order total or weight to ensure customers can complete purchases.
- Third-Party Shipping Apps: Explore robust third-party shipping solutions from the Shopify App Store. Many offer advanced rate calculation and can act as a reliable alternative, often with more features than native integrations. This might be a good long-term solution anyway for complex shipping needs.
3. Proactive Monitoring and Best Practices
Once resolved, or if you're looking to prevent future issues:
- Regularly Test Shipping Rates: Periodically run test orders through your checkout to ensure rates are displaying correctly.
- Stay Informed: Keep an eye on Shopify announcements and community forums for known issues.
- Diversify Shipping Options: Relying solely on one carrier's integration can be risky. Consider offering multiple carrier options if feasible for your business.
How Shopping Cart Mover Can Help
As experts in e-commerce migrations and platform optimization, Shopping Cart Mover understands that shipping is the backbone of your online store. Issues like broken carrier-calculated rates can severely impact conversion rates and customer trust. Whether you're migrating to Shopify and need to ensure a flawless shipping setup, or you're an existing merchant facing integration challenges, our team can provide:
- Pre-Migration Shipping Strategy: Ensuring your new Shopify store has a robust and reliable shipping configuration from day one.
- Integration Troubleshooting: Assisting with complex API integrations and ensuring all your e-commerce components communicate effectively.
- App Recommendations: Guiding you to the best third-party shipping apps that fit your business needs and provide stability.
Don't let technical glitches derail your sales. Proactive management and expert assistance are key to maintaining a smooth, efficient e-commerce operation. If you're struggling with Shopify shipping issues or planning a migration, reach out to Shopping Cart Mover – we're here to help you move forward seamlessly.